// SPDX-License-Identifier: BUSL-1.1
//! RESTORE TENANT orchestrator logic.
//!
//! Validates a backup envelope, merges all sections into a single
//! `TenantDataSnapshot`, then splits the merged snapshot into per-node
//! sub-snapshots according to the *current* cluster topology and
//! dispatches `MetaOp::RestoreTenantSnapshot` to each owning node.
//!
//! Durable re-issue of columnar/timeseries/vector rows lives in [`reissue`];
//! post-install surrogate rebinding and tombstone warnings live in
//! [`rebind`].
mod rebind;
mod reissue;
use std::sync::Arc;
use nodedb_types::backup_envelope::{
DEFAULT_MAX_TOTAL_BYTES, parse_encrypted as parse_envelope_encrypted,
};
use serde::Serialize;
use crate::Error;
use crate::bridge::envelope::PhysicalPlan;
use crate::control::server::shared::ddl::sync_dispatch;
use crate::control::state::SharedState;
use crate::types::TenantId;
use nodedb_physical::physical_plan::MetaOp;
use super::remote::{NODE_RESTORE_TIMEOUT, dispatch_remote, envelope_to_err};
use super::sections::{apply_metadata_sections, merge_sections};
use super::topology::{SplitOutput, is_self, split_by_current_topology};
/// Aggregate stats returned to the client at the end of a restore.
#[derive(Debug, Default, Clone, Serialize)]
pub struct RestoreStats {
pub tenant_id: u64,
pub dry_run: bool,
pub sections: u16,
pub source_vshard_count: u16,
pub documents: usize,
pub indexes: usize,
pub edges: usize,
pub vectors: usize,
pub kv_tables: usize,
pub crdt_state: usize,
pub timeseries: usize,
pub columnar_engines: usize,
pub flushed_ts_segments: usize,
/// Number of timeseries collections re-issued durably (Raft/WAL) on restore.
pub timeseries_reissued: usize,
/// Number of CRDT tenant-snapshot imports re-issued durably (Raft/WAL) on
/// restore — one per distinct data group that owns any CRDT collection.
pub crdt_reissued: usize,
/// Number of individual vectors re-issued durably (Raft/WAL) on restore.
pub vectors_reissued: usize,
/// Number of (collection, field) vector-index HNSW/PQ/IVF configs
/// re-issued durably (Raft/WAL) on restore.
pub vector_params_reissued: usize,
/// Number of PK→surrogate identity bindings rebound into the catalog.
pub surrogate_pk: usize,
pub nodes_dispatched: usize,
/// Non-zero = snapshot contained unparseable keys (possible corruption).
pub malformed_keys: usize,
/// Non-zero = some entries were routed to local node due to missing shard leader.
pub route_fallbacks: usize,
}
/// Restore a tenant from a fully-buffered backup envelope.
pub async fn restore_tenant(
state: &Arc<SharedState>,
tenant_id: u64,
envelope_bytes: &[u8],
dry_run: bool,
force: bool,
) -> Result<RestoreStats, Error> {
let env = match &state.backup_kek {
Some(kek) => parse_envelope_encrypted(envelope_bytes, DEFAULT_MAX_TOTAL_BYTES, kek)
.map_err(envelope_to_err)?,
None => {
return Err(Error::Internal {
detail: "restore: envelope is encrypted but no backup KEK is configured; \
set [backup_encryption] in the server config"
.into(),
});
}
};
if env.meta.tenant_id != tenant_id {
return Err(Error::Internal {
detail: format!(
"backup tenant mismatch: envelope has {}, request is for {}",
env.meta.tenant_id, tenant_id
),
});
}
if !dry_run && env.meta.snapshot_watermark != 0 {
let current_high_water = state
.tenant_write_hlc
.lock()
.ok()
.and_then(|map| map.get(&tenant_id).copied())
.unwrap_or(0);
if env.meta.snapshot_watermark < current_high_water {
if force {
tracing::warn!(
tenant_id,
envelope_watermark = env.meta.snapshot_watermark,
current_high_water,
"restore staleness protection explicitly overridden via FORCE: \
envelope watermark is older than the destination cluster's last \
observed write-HLC for this tenant — newer writes will be overwritten"
);
} else {
return Err(Error::Internal {
detail: format!(
"restore refused: envelope watermark {} is older than the \
destination cluster's last observed write-HLC {} for tenant \
{} — newer writes would be silently overwritten",
env.meta.snapshot_watermark, current_high_water, tenant_id
),
});
}
}
}
let mut stats = RestoreStats {
tenant_id,
dry_run,
sections: env.sections.len() as u16,
source_vshard_count: env.meta.source_vshard_count,
..Default::default()
};
if !dry_run {
apply_metadata_sections(state, tenant_id, &env)?;
}
let mut merged = merge_sections(&env.sections)?;
stats.documents = merged.documents.len();
stats.indexes = merged.indexes.len();
stats.edges = merged.edges.len();
stats.vectors = merged.vectors.len();
stats.kv_tables = merged.kv_tables.len();
// CRDT state is one entry per (tenant, collection).
stats.crdt_state = merged.crdt_state.len();
stats.timeseries = merged.timeseries.len();
stats.flushed_ts_segments = merged.flushed_ts_segments.len();
stats.surrogate_pk = merged.surrogate_pk.len();
rebind::warn_on_tombstoned_restores(state, tenant_id, &merged, env.meta.snapshot_watermark);
if dry_run {
stats.columnar_engines = merged.columnar_engines.len();
return Ok(stats);
}
// Plain-columnar engine state is NOT installed via the snapshot path (that
// lands in in-memory-only Data Plane maps — lost on restart, never
// replicated). Drain it here and re-issue durably below as
// `ColumnarOp::Insert`s. The topology split must therefore never see
// columnar engines.
let columnar_snapshots = std::mem::take(&mut merged.columnar_engines);
// Timeseries engine state (memtable section + flushed on-disk segments) is
// likewise NOT installed via the snapshot path — `restore_timeseries` and
// `restore_flushed_ts_segments` do a per-node DIRECT install that is never
// Raft-replicated, so on a multi-replica cluster the data lands on only one
// node. Drain both sections here and re-issue durably below as
// `TimeseriesOp::Ingest`s (Raft-replicated in cluster mode; WAL-appended
// then installed in single-node mode). The topology split must therefore
// never see timeseries data — otherwise it would be double-installed.
let timeseries_memtables = std::mem::take(&mut merged.timeseries);
let flushed_ts_segments = std::mem::take(&mut merged.flushed_ts_segments);
// CRDT state is NOT installed via the per-node snapshot fan-out: that
// dispatch is race-prone (skips data groups with no leader yet) and not
// durable across restart. Drain the per-collection CRDT section here and
// re-issue durably below as `CrdtOp::ImportSnapshot` (Raft-replicated in
// cluster mode; WAL-appended then installed in single-node mode). The
// topology split must therefore never see CRDT state — otherwise the
// coordinator would double-import.
let crdt_state = std::mem::take(&mut merged.crdt_state);
// Vector engine state is likewise NOT installed via the snapshot path —
// `restore_vector_collection` installs straight into the in-memory-only
// `vector_collections` Data Plane map with no WAL record and no Raft
// entry, so it is lost on restart (single-node) and never replicated
// (cluster). Drain it here and re-issue durably below, one
// `VectorOp::Insert` per restored vector (Raft-replicated in cluster
// mode; WAL-appended then installed in single-node mode). The topology
// split must therefore never see vector data — otherwise it would be
// double-installed.
let vector_snapshots = std::mem::take(&mut merged.vectors);
// Vector-index HNSW/PQ/IVF configuration (metric, M, ef_construction,
// quantization/index_type) is captured at backup alongside the raw
// vectors above (see `TenantDataSnapshot::vector_params` /
// `::index_configs` doc comments) but is likewise NOT installed via the
// snapshot path. Drain both here and re-issue durably below as
// `VectorOp::SetParams` — BEFORE the vector `Insert` re-issue, since
// `get_or_create_vector_index` lazily creates the Data Plane HNSW index
// from `self.vector_params` on the first `Insert` it sees for a
// (collection, field), defaulting silently if no `SetParams` landed
// first. The topology split must therefore never see these sections.
let vector_params_snapshots = std::mem::take(&mut merged.vector_params);
let index_config_snapshots = std::mem::take(&mut merged.index_configs);
// Drain the PK→surrogate identity map before the topology split (the split
// only routes per-key engine data). It is rebound into the destination
// catalog after the data install dispatches succeed — without it restored
// documents are unreachable by PK point-lookup (`WHERE id=<pk>`).
let surrogate_binds = std::mem::take(&mut merged.surrogate_pk);
let SplitOutput {
buckets,
malformed_keys,
route_fallbacks,
} = split_by_current_topology(state, tenant_id, merged);
stats.nodes_dispatched = buckets.len();
stats.malformed_keys = malformed_keys;
stats.route_fallbacks = route_fallbacks;
if malformed_keys > 0 {
tracing::warn!(
tenant_id,
count = malformed_keys,
"restore: snapshot contained keys that did not parse — possible corruption"
);
}
if route_fallbacks > 0 {
tracing::warn!(
tenant_id,
count = route_fallbacks,
"restore: routed some entries to local node because no current leader was visible"
);
}
let mut local_plan: Option<PhysicalPlan> = None;
let mut remote_futs = Vec::with_capacity(buckets.len());
for (node_id, sub) in buckets {
let payload = zerompk::to_msgpack_vec(&sub).map_err(|e| Error::Internal {
detail: format!("restore: snapshot encode failed: {e}"),
})?;
let plan = PhysicalPlan::Meta(MetaOp::RestoreTenantSnapshot {
tenant_id,
snapshot: payload,
// User RESTORE keeps the fail-closed collision behavior.
replace_mode: false,
clear_vshards: Vec::new(),
collections_to_clear: Vec::new(),
});
if is_self(state, node_id) {
local_plan = Some(plan);
} else {
let state = state.clone();
remote_futs
.push(async move { dispatch_remote(&state, node_id, tenant_id, plan).await });
}
}
if let Some(plan) = local_plan {
sync_dispatch::dispatch_async(
state,
TenantId::new(tenant_id),
// TODO(A8-followup): backup/restore not yet multi-database.
crate::types::DatabaseId::DEFAULT,
"__system",
plan,
NODE_RESTORE_TIMEOUT,
)
.await?;
}
let results = futures::future::join_all(remote_futs).await;
if let Some(first_err) = results.into_iter().find_map(Result::err) {
return Err(first_err);
}
// Rebind the PK→surrogate identity map into the destination catalog now
// that the data is installed. The catalog is the SOURCE OF TRUTH the
// planner consults for PK point-lookups (`surrogate_assigner.lookup(pk)`);
// a missing binding makes a restored row unreachable by PK even though it
// is present in the doc store. A rebind failure is FATAL — silently
// shipping unqueryable rows is the partial-success anti-pattern this
// codebase forbids.
rebind::rebind_surrogates(state, surrogate_binds)?;
// Durable re-issue of plain-columnar rows. Each restored collection's live
// rows are decoded from the snapshot and replayed as a durable
// `ColumnarOp::Insert` (Raft-replicated in cluster mode; WAL-appended then
// installed in single-node mode). Collections that decode to zero live rows
// are skipped. Any failure is fatal — no warn-and-continue.
stats.columnar_engines =
reissue::reissue_columnar_snapshots(state, tenant_id, columnar_snapshots).await?;
// Durable re-issue of timeseries rows. Each restored collection's memtable
// rows plus every flushed partition's rows are decoded from the snapshot and
// replayed as a durable `TimeseriesOp::Ingest` (Raft-replicated in cluster
// mode; WAL-appended then installed in single-node mode). Collections that
// decode to zero live rows are skipped. Any failure is fatal — no
// warn-and-continue.
stats.timeseries_reissued = reissue::reissue_timeseries_snapshots(
state,
tenant_id,
timeseries_memtables,
flushed_ts_segments,
)
.await?;
// Durable re-issue of CRDT state. Each collection's Loro snapshot is
// proposed through Raft to the data group owning that collection's vshard
// (Raft-replicated in cluster mode; WAL-appended then installed in
// single-node mode). Every replica applies the same idempotent Loro merge
// and converges deterministically. Any failure is fatal — no
// warn-and-continue.
stats.crdt_reissued = super::crdt_reissue::reissue_crdt_snapshots(state, crdt_state).await?;
// Durable re-issue of vector-index configuration. Each restored
// (collection, field) HNSW/PQ/IVF config is replayed as a
// `VectorOp::SetParams` (Raft-replicated in cluster mode; WAL-appended
// then installed in single-node mode). MUST run before the vector-insert
// re-issue below — see the `vector_params_snapshots` drain comment
// above. Any failure is fatal — no warn-and-continue.
stats.vector_params_reissued = reissue::reissue_vector_params(
state,
tenant_id,
vector_params_snapshots,
index_config_snapshots,
)
.await?;
// Durable re-issue of vector rows. Each restored vector is replayed as an
// individual `VectorOp::Insert` (Raft-replicated in cluster mode;
// WAL-appended then installed in single-node mode). Collections that
// decode to zero vectors are skipped. Any failure is fatal — no
// warn-and-continue.
stats.vectors_reissued =
reissue::reissue_vector_snapshots(state, tenant_id, vector_snapshots).await?;
Ok(stats)
}
